Output 21db80fb8a5815c8e9d03e43976baeac675639455fc62926c87aa777c46a7fe2:0

value
3325842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 030907462992ceaa1c7b78c4dd4eb77fabdb75e3 OP_EQUAL
address
31y4mRaB3r87QybwVXPV5RnnhD683spZkj
transaction
21db80fb8a5815c8e9d03e43976baeac675639455fc62926c87aa777c46a7fe2
spent
true